It used to be my family’s first PC, bought in 2007. Despite being old, everything still worked, except for PSU that was replaced around 2013. But I needed a new PC, and I decided to make it into a sleeper.
The case is one of Microlab 4103 models, but I don’t know exactly whether it’s M4103, S4103 or C4103. It’s very hard to find info about them online, due to their age. Money are tight, so I decided to go without a dedicated GPU for now, using integrated GPU. I has been using it for almost a month, and it’s been a blast. It runs nice and quiet, and square monitor is perfect for old games, no “widescreen fix” necessary, and it can handle old and some modern games as well.
Full specs:
* CPU: AMD Ryzen 5 7600, 3.8 GHz, AM5, 6 cores, 12 threads
* Motherboard: MSI PRO B650-S WiFi, ATX
* RAM: TeamGroup T.Create Expert 2 × 16 GB DDR5-6000 CL30
* SSD: Kingston Fury Renegade 500 GB NVMe, M.2-2280, PCIe 4.0×4
* HDD: Seagate SkyHawk Surveillance 4 TB, 3.5″ SATA, 5000 RPM
* ODD: Sony NEC Optiarc AD-7173A 5.25″ PATA (IDE) DVD reader/writer with LabelFlash (connected with a IDE-to-SATA adapter from AliExpress)
* PSU: Zalman ZM500-GS, 500 W, ATX non-modular
* CPU cooler: Thermalright Assassin X 90 SE ARGB, 4 heatpipes, 92 mm fan
* Case fans: 3 × Cooler Master SickleFlow 80 mm, PWM
* Case fan: DeepCool XFAN 5, PCI slot blower fan, DC
* USB 2.0 type A × 4 and USB-C ports for PCI slots from AliExpress
* OS: Pop_OS! 22.04 LTS
* Wallpaper: Bliss.bmp [(600 dpi 16 megapixel version)](https://archive.org/details/bliss-600dpi_202006)
Peripherals:
* Display: Acer AL1717, 17″ 5:4 1280×1024 SXGA 60 Hz LCD with integrated stereo speakers (connected through HDMI-to-VGA adapter from AliExpress)
* Keyboard: Logitech K120, wired USB rubber dome membrane, 105 keys, Russian layout
* Mouse: A4Tech OP-720, wired USB optical, red LED
* Controller: Logitech F310, wired USB
* Sound: Logitech S-220, 17W 2.1 sound system
